Ir para o conteúdo

Como soluciono o "Your requested instance type is not supported in your requested Availability Zone" erro que recebo ao executar uma instância do EC2?

3 minuto de leitura
0

Quando tento executar uma instância do Amazon Elastic Compute Cloud (Amazon EC2), recebo o erro "Your requested instance type is not supported in your requested Availability Zone". Quero determinar a zona de disponibilidade que posso usar e solucionar o erro.

Resolução

Observação: se você receber erros ao executar comandos da AWS Command Line Interface (AWS CLI), consulte Solução de problemas da AWS CLI. Além disso, verifique se você está usando a versão mais recente da AWS CLI.

Determine as zonas de disponibilidade que suportam seu tipo de instância

É possível usar o console do Amazon Elastic Compute Cloud (Amazon EC2) ou a AWS CLI para determinar as zonas de disponibilidade que suportam seu tipo de instância.

Console do Amazon EC2

Conclua as seguintes etapas:

  1. Abra o console do Amazon EC2.
  2. Selecione a região da AWS em que você deseja executar a instância.
  3. No painel de navegação, selecione Tipos de instância.
  4. Em Filtrar tipos de instância, insira seu tipo de instância preferido.
  5. Selecione seu tipo de instância.
  6. Na seção Rede, consulte as zonas de disponibilidade listadas em Zonas de disponibilidade.

AWS CLI

Execute o comando describe-instance-type-offerings e inclua filtros para a zona de disponibilidade e o tipo de instância que você quer executar. Também é possível incluir outros filtros.

O comando de exemplo a seguir filtra os resultados da pesquisa por zona de disponibilidade, tipo de instância e região:

# aws ec2 describe-instance-type-offerings --location-type availability-zone  --filters Name=instance-type,Values=c5.xlarge --region af-south-1 --output table

Observação: Os nomes das zonas de disponibilidade podem não ser mapeados para o mesmo local em todas as contas da AWS. No comando describe-instance-type-offerings, use a opção de tipo de localização availability-zone-id para incluir IDs de zona de disponibilidade na lista de saída. É possível usar o ID da zona de disponibilidade para verificar o mapeamento da zona de disponibilidade em sua conta.

Tente fazer a solicitação novamente

Para executar uma instância em uma zona de disponibilidade compatível, use o assistente de inicialização de instâncias no console do Amazon EC2 ou use a AWS CLI.

Também não é possível especificar uma zona de disponibilidade em sua solicitação. Se você não especificar uma zona de disponibilidade, o Amazon EC2 escolherá uma zona de disponibilidade para você que ofereça suporte ao seu tipo de instância.

Informações relacionadas

Capacidade insuficiente da instância

AWS OFICIALAtualizada há 7 meses